在CentOS上安装Python依赖,通常需要使用包管理器yum
或dnf
(CentOS 8及更高版本)来安装Python包。以下是一些基本步骤:
yum
(CentOS 7及更低版本)更新系统包:
sudo yum update -y
安装Python及其依赖:
sudo yum install python3 python3-pip -y
安装特定Python包:
假设你需要安装requests
库,可以使用以下命令:
pip3 install requests
dnf
(CentOS 8及更高版本)更新系统包:
sudo dnf update -y
安装Python及其依赖:
sudo dnf install python3 python3-pip -y
安装特定Python包:
同样,假设你需要安装requests
库,可以使用以下命令:
pip3 install requests
为了避免全局安装的Python包之间的冲突,建议使用虚拟环境。以下是如何创建和使用虚拟环境的步骤:
安装virtualenv
:
pip3 install virtualenv
创建虚拟环境:
virtualenv myenv
激活虚拟环境:
source myenv/bin/activate
在虚拟环境中安装包:
pip install requests
退出虚拟环境:
deactivate
conda
(可选)如果你更喜欢使用Anaconda或Miniconda来管理Python环境和包,可以按照以下步骤操作:
下载并安装Miniconda:
wget https://repo.anaconda.com/miniconda/Miniconda3-latest-Linux-x86_64.sh
bash Miniconda3-latest-Linux-x86_64.sh
创建新的conda环境:
conda create -n myenv python=3.8
激活conda环境:
conda activate myenv
在conda环境中安装包:
conda install requests
退出conda环境:
conda deactivate
通过以上步骤,你可以在CentOS上安装和管理Python依赖。选择适合你需求的方法进行操作即可。